#58344f color RGB value is (88,52,79). #58344f color name is Custom Color color.

#58344f hex color red value is 88, green value is 52 and the blue value of its RGB is 79.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#58344f hue: 0.88, saturation: 0.26 and the lightness value of 58344f is 0.27.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#58344f color hex is 0.00, 0.41, 0.10, 0.65. Web safe color of #58344f is #663366. Color #58344f contains mainly PINK color.

About #58344F Custom Color

#58344F (Custom Color) is a pink-based color with RGB values of 88, 52, 79. This color belongs to the pink color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#58344f,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#58344f can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#58344f), RGB (rgb(88, 52, 79)), HSL (hsl(315, 26%, 27%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#663366,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
